The Type 2 Diabetes Score in 31557, Patterson, Georgia is 18 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

86.15 percent of the population in 31557 drive to work alone. 1.17 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 59.27 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 2.48 percent of the residents in 31557 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.47 members with about 2.07 cars available per household.

An estimate of 78.39 percent of the residents in 31557 has some form of health insurance. 40.69 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 46.19 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 31557 would have to travel an average of 20.40 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Wayne Memorial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 31557, Patterson, Georgia.

Type 2 Diabetes is a condition characterized by high levels of blood sugar resulting from the body's inability to use insulin properly. It can lead to serious health complications if not managed effectively. Individuals with Type 2 Diabetes require regular check-ups, medication management, and lifestyle support to maintain their health and prevent complications such as heart disease, stroke, kidney disease, and nerve damage.

Understanding the history of the area can provide valuable insights for potential movers considering a relocation to 31557. Patterson has a rich history dating back to its establishment in the late 1800s as a railroad town. The town thrived as a hub for timber production and agriculture, contributing to its growth and development over the years.
